Direct air capture: Removal candidate

The claim cannot be classified yet. Ask first where the CO2 came from and where the carbon ends up.

Carbon fate
Pulled from ambient air, then only becomes removal if stored durably.
Failure mode
The capture figure alone is not the removal figure.

Evidence to ask for

  • Energy source and full lifecycle emissions
  • Storage permanence and monitoring plan
  • Whether quoted costs are measured operation or future projection
